📌 I. Product Definition & Classification: Do You Really Understand "Rearview Cameras"?
A Rearview Camera is a critical safety component in modern automotive systems, often referred to as a "reverse parking aid system." In international trade, these devices are not simply "cameras"; they are complex electronic assemblies involving imaging sensors, signal processing, and transmission modules. Their classification depends heavily on their primary function and technical architecture:
- Pure Imaging/Video Signal Devices: If the device is primarily for providing a visual image to the driver (e.g., LCD screen or just the camera unit outputting video), it may fall under Chapter 85 (Electrical Machinery) or Chapter 90 (Optical/Medical).
- Radio Navigation/Aid Devices: If the system is integrated with radar, ultrasonic sensors, or specific navigation logic, it may be classified as a Radio Navigation Aid.
- Specialized Electronic Machines: If it has an independent function beyond simple video transmission (e.g., object detection algorithms, independent processing unit), it might be classified under 8543 (Other Electrical Machines).
⚠️ Key Distinction Point: - If it is a standalone camera outputting video for display → Likely 8512 (Visual Signaling Equipment) or 8526 (Radio Navigation/Aids). - If it is a system with processing/detection logic (e.g., blind-spot detection + rear view) → Likely 8543 (Other Electrical Machines) or 8526 (Radar/Navigation). - Do not classify as a general consumer camera (Chapter 85 or 90) if it is designed specifically for automotive assistance.
📦 II. HS Code Classification Details (2026 Latest Tariff Authority Comparison)
| HS Code | Product Description | Applicable Scenario | Tax Rate (Total) | Tax Detail Breakdown |
|---|---|---|---|---|
8526.91.00.40 |
Imaging Rear View Display/Aid System | Systems classified as Radio Navigation Aids. Often used when the camera is part of a broader navigation or safety network. | 35.0% | Base Tariff: 0.0% Additional Tariff: 25.0% Section 122 Tariff: 10% |
8512.20.40.80 |
Vehicle Auxiliary Visual Equipment | Fits the definition of Visual Signaling Equipment. Standard rearview cameras that primarily provide visual signals to the driver. | 37.5% | Base Tariff: 2.5% Additional Tariff: 25.0% Section 122 Tariff: 10% |
8543.70.98.60 |
Independent Functional Electronic Detection Device | Devices with independent functions that do not fit strictly into navigation or signaling categories. E.g., advanced AI-driven parking aids. | 37.6% | Base Tariff: 2.6% Additional Tariff: 25.0% Section 122 Tariff: 10% |
8543.70.60.00 |
Electronic Detection Device | Designed to connect to vehicle electronic networks or sensor systems. Focuses on the detection/communication aspect rather than pure video. | 35.0% | Base Tariff: 0.0% Additional Tariff: 25.0% Section 122 Tariff: 10% |
8526.10.00.40 |
Radar Device | If the "camera" system is actually a Radar-based parking aid (often integrated with cameras but primarily radar-driven). | 35.0% | Base Tariff: 0.0% Additional Tariff: 25.0% Section 122 Tariff: 10% |
🔍 Critical Reminder: - 8512 vs. 8526: The key difference is whether the device is considered a "visual signaling equipment" (8512) or a "radio navigation aid" (8526). If it’s a simple camera, 8512.20.40.80 is often the most accurate, but 8526.91.00.40 is competitive if the system has navigation/safety integration. - 8543 Usage: Use 8543.70.60.00 or 8543.70.98.60 only if the device has significant independent processing power or detection logic that doesn’t fit neatly into 8512/8526. The tax rates are similar, but the legal basis differs. - Radar Distinction: If the system uses radar waves for distance measurement (even if it displays video), 8526.10.00.40 may apply.

📌 VI. Common Errors & Pitfall Avoidance (Blood Lessons)
❌ Error 1: Calling a "Radar Camera" just a "Camera"
👉 Consequence: If customs suspects radar, they may reclassify to 8526.10.00.40 and fine you for misdeclaration.
✅ Fix: Clearly state "Camera with Radar Integration" or "Radar Parking Aid."
❌ Error 2: Using 8512 for AI-Powered Aids
👉 Consequence: Customs may reject 8512 as "too simple" and force 8543.70.98.60 (37.6%), causing delays.
✅ Fix: Provide technical docs showing independent processing for 8543 or 8526.
❌ Error 3: Missing FCC ID
👉 Consequence: US Customs and Border Protection (CBP) will detain the goods until FCC compliance is proven.
✅ Fix: Include FCC ID on every product and invoice.
❌ Error 4: Inconsistent Descriptions
👉 Consequence: Invoice says "Camera," Packing List says "Parking Sensor," HS Code says "Radar."
✅ Fix: Ensure Invoice, Packing List, and HS Code all align with the primary function.

关于 HS 编码归类
协调制度(HS)是由世界海关组织(WCO)制定的国际贸易商品分类标准。全球 200 多个国家采用 HS 系统作为海关关税、贸易统计和进出口监管的基础。
每个 HS 编码遵循以下层级结构:
- 章(2 位)——商品大类(例如:第 84 章:机器和机械设备)
- 品目(4 位)——章内的更具体分类
- 子目(6 位)——国际通用细分,所有 WCO 成员国统一使用
- 本国细分(8-10 位)——各国自行扩展的细分编码,如美国 HTSUS 10 位编码
正确的 HS 编码归类对于顺利通关、准确缴纳关税和遵守贸易法规至关重要。错误归类可能导致海关延误、多缴关税或罚款。
